David Beckham to star in Only Fools and Horses sketch

Los Angeles - David Beckham will appear in Only Fools and Horses.

The retired soccer star - who is one of the show's "biggest fans" - has filmed a cameo appearance in a special Sport Relief sketch which reunites Del Boy (Sir David Jason) and Rodney (Nicholas Lyndhurst) for the first time in over a decade.

The sketch, due to air on Friday, March 21, will see David join the Trotter brothers in a greasy spoon café in Peckham, London.

Kevin Cahill, Comic Relief's CEO, said: "To be able to record a new Only Fools and Horses sketch is in itself very special but for David Beckham, who is a huge fan of the show, to be part of this is truly brilliant. We would like to thank everyone involved for helping to make this happen.''

The Only Fools and Horses revival marks the first time the comedy duo have graced TV screens together since the 2003 Christmas special.

Fans of the long-running show, which ended in 1981, were devastated to hear of Roger Lloyd-Pack's death last week.

The beloved actor - who played gullible Trigger in the BBC sitcom - passed away aged 69 from pancreatic cancer.

This isn't the first time that David has put his acting skills to the test for Sport Relief, with the hunky star most recently taking part in a 2012 comedy sketch which saw him getting into bed and sharing a bath with James Corden.
